<strong>The</strong> Autobiography <strong>of</strong> <strong>Archbishop</strong> Thomas Seeker<br />

gave also Horton R. to Mr Fausset, bee. the Income was sunk so, that<br />

no body cared to take it; & he being a man <strong>of</strong> Substance, was most likely<br />

to raise it. Also Newchurch R & V {to} 120 u , to Mr Robt Tournay,<br />

recommended by the D. <strong>of</strong> Newcastle. Dr Fowell marrying & leaving me<br />

this Year, I took Mr, now Dr, Stinton <strong>of</strong> Exeter Coll. for my Chaplain &<br />

gave him Wittrisham R. 220 11 in August. I gave Mr Gurney Whitstable<br />

C abt 40^. In the End <strong>of</strong> this Year & beginning <strong>of</strong> 1766 I had a long Fit<br />

<strong>of</strong> the Gout, like that <strong>of</strong> the preceding Year. I engaged Mr Ridley to<br />

write his Review <strong>of</strong> Phillips's Life <strong>of</strong> Card. Pole, & assisted him greatly<br />

in it, revising the whole in MS. And I gave him my Option-Prebend <strong>of</strong><br />

Sarum, worth communibus annis near 200^. I knew not beforehand <strong>of</strong><br />

Dr Neves Design to write on the same Subject. I also encouraged Mr<br />

Bell, whom I had before recommended to Princess Amelia for her<br />

Chaplain, to write a Defence <strong>of</strong> Revelation, agst the pretended Rational<br />

Christian. After he had written it once over, I induced him to throw it<br />

into a new Form, suggested to him innumerable Corrections, Additions,<br />

& Improvements, & wrote the last Chapter almost intirely.<br />

<strong>The</strong> King having expressed to me his Desire in 1765 that I would<br />

publish a volume <strong>of</strong> Sermons, I did so in the Beginning <strong>of</strong> 1766. I paid<br />

Mr Rivington for some Copies <strong>of</strong> the former volume, which I gave away,<br />

besides those which he allowed me: but not now: How many I had each<br />

time, I do not remember.]<br />

In the beginning <strong>of</strong> 1766 I gave to Dr Uri a Hungarian, now at<br />

Oxford, 10 Guineas, wch I must continue yearly.<br />

I gave also towards the Repair <strong>of</strong> Sittingbourn Church, 50 1 *. And I<br />

had written before & printed & sent about at my own Expence, a Letter,<br />

recommending the Brief for it, throughout my own Dioceses: which<br />

greatly increased the Collection. It amounted to 600 11 or more.<br />

I gave also to the Fire at Montreal in Canada, 30 1 *.<br />

And to Mrs Thornhill, formerly Reyner, a relation <strong>of</strong> Mr Hollister, I<br />

gave this year 20 1 *. I had given her 70 11 before. I have also given to Mrs<br />

Judith Boddington, a neighbour & Friend <strong>of</strong> his, at different times, 80^.<br />

I joined with Ld Radnor in paying the Expences <strong>of</strong> a Bill for securing<br />

the Church & Harbour <strong>of</strong> Folkestone. Each half was 84 11 . On this<br />

Occasion I was not well used by Ld Radnor. See the Letters relative to<br />

it.<br />

FOLIO 65 I gave Mr Ray cr<strong>of</strong>t, Son in Law to Dr Stonehewer my<br />

1766 Fellow-Chaplain, the Livings <strong>of</strong> Patching & Terring, worth<br />

each abt 80 11 a Year. And the Houses being in bad<br />

Condition, I gave him 100 11 towards Building & Repairs.<br />

This Year I have paid the last <strong>of</strong> Burkitts Expences for keeping<br />

Terms & taking his Batchelors Degree at Oxford; which have been<br />

above 125 11 , & 3* 1 since & above 6 11 more.
